Epoxy Flooring: A Long-lasting and Attractive Upgrade

Considering a significant update for your garage ? This flooring system presents a excellent solution, offering both exceptional strength and a stunning aesthetic. Unlike conventional flooring options, epoxy creates a seamless and waterproof surface that is easy to clean and very tough to withstand heavy foot traffic . Beyond its useful benefits, epoxy allows for incredible design choices, from understated solid colors to intricate custom designs and decorative effects, truly elevating the appearance of your space.

Polished Concrete vs. Epoxy Flooring: Which is Best?

Choosing between honed concrete and epoxy flooring for your space can be confusing, as both offer attractive and durable surfaces. Polished concrete presents a contemporary aesthetic with a natural appearance, requiring not much ongoing maintenance . However, it can be pricier to put in initially. Epoxy flooring, on the other hand, provides a flawless surface with virtually limitless customization possibilities , making it perfect for commercial spaces . It's generally a more budget-friendly option but might necessitate regular sealing to maintain its appearance .
